Location

Leigham is located in the North East of Plymouth in a popular area with an Asda Supermarket, Torr Bridge High (Secondary School), Leigham Primary School, Dental Practice and Veterinary Hospital all within close proximity.

Good access links to Forder Valley, A38 at Marsh Mills, Tavistock Road and Crownhill Road.

Estover industrial Estate is within a short distance. The George Junction with its Public House (The George), Park & Ride (to Derriford Hospital and City Centre) & Roborough Surgery is within minutes of the property. Further supermarkets can be found at Woolwell Roundabout (Tesco & Lidl).

Leigham Wood is located in the east of Plymouth just north of the Marsh Mills Retail Park. The 5ha site is owned and managed by The Woodland Trust and is accessible to the public. This site consists predominantly of broadleaved woodland.

The site is designated as a County Wildlife Site because part of the area is registered on the Ancient Woodland Inventory, supporting more-or-less semi-natural woodland. 20 ancient woodland indicator species have been identified within the ground flora including barren strawberry, wild cherry, field-rose, crab apple and hairy wood-rush.
